> SURA LXX (70)  - The Steps or Ascents (Mecca - 44 verses)       (XLVII - 72)  
>  
>        In the Name of God, the Compassionate, the Merciful
>  
>        A suitor sued for punishment to light suddenly
>  
>        On the infidels:  None can hinder
>  
>        God from inflicting it, the master of those Ascents,
>  
>        By which the angels and the spirit ascend to him in a day, whose length
> is fifty thousand years.
>  
>        Be thou patient therefore with becoming patience;
>  
>        They forsooth regard that day as distant,
>  
>        But we see it nigh:
>  
>        The day when the heavens shall become as molten brass,
>  
>        And the mountains shall become like flocks of wool:
>  
> 70:10  And friend shall not question of friend,
>  
>        Though they look at one another.  Fain would the wicked redeem himself
> from punishment on that day at the price of his children,
>  
>        Of his spouse and his brother,
>  
>        And of his kindred who shewed affection for him,
>  
>        And of all who are on the earth that then it might deliver him.
>  
>        But no.  For the fire,
>  
>        Dragging by the scalp,
>  
>        Shall claim him who turned his back and went away,
>  
>        And amassed and hoarded.
>  
>        Man truly is by creation hasty;
>  
> 70:20  When evil befalleth him, impatient;
>  
>        But when good falleth to his lot, tenacious.
>  
>        No so the prayerful,
>  
>        Who are ever constant at their prayers;
>  
>        And of whose substance there is a due and stated portion
>  
>        For him who asketh, and for him who is ashamed to beg;
>  
>        And who own the judgment-day a truth,
>  
>        And who thrill with dread at the chastisement of their Lord -
>  
>        For there is none safe from the chastisement of their Lord -
>  
>        And who control their desires,
>  
> 70:30  (Save with their wives or the slaves whom their right hands have won,
> for there they shall be blameless;
>  
>        But whoever indulge their desires beyond this are transgressors);
>  
>        And who are true to their trusts and their engagements,
>  
>        And who witness uprightly,
>  
>        And who keep strictly the hours of prayer:
>  
>        These shall dwell, laden with honours, amid gardens.
>  
>        But what hath come to the unbelievers that they run at full stretch
> around thee,
>  
>        On the right hand and on the left, in bands?
>  
>        Is it that every man of them would fain enter that garden of delights?
>  
>        Not at all.  We have created them, they know of what.
>  
> 70:40  It needs not that I swear by the Lord of the East and of the West that
> we have power
>  
>        To replace them with better than themselves:  neither are we to be
> hindred.
>  
>        Wherefore let them flounder on and disport them, till they come face to
> face with their threatened day,
>  
>        The day on which they shall flock up out of their graves in haste like
> men who rally to a standard: -
>  
>        Their eyes downcast; disgrace shall cover them.  Such their threatened
> day.
